Page 227 - The contemporaneous construction of a. statute by those charged with its execution, especially when it has long prevailed, is entitled to great weight, and should not be disregarded or overturned except for cogent reasons, and unless it be clear that such construction is erroneous.

Page 227 - A statute should be construed so that effect is given to all its provisions, so that no part will be inoperative or superfluous, void or insignificant, and so that one section will not destroy another unless the provision is the result of obvious mistake or error.

Page 148 - Cadets and midshipmen. Cadets and midshipmen suffering from disabilities incurred in the line of duty while assigned to duties constituting war service, which includes practice cruises at sea but excludes practice maneuvers at West Point, during the period of one of the hostilities enumerated in § 35.011 are entitled to a pension for such disability at the rate provided in § 35.011, if otherwise entitled.
